    When I choose to rip my files to WAV, all tags are there (including the album image) + the album image in the album folder. I always check it with tag editors like Tag&Rename, or others
    But what I don't understand is why when I choose to import my album into Apple Music, using the classic Library/import function, no tag is taken into account
    Only the name of the song appears in the collection in this form: artist name - song name
    Only Apple Music does this
    Is this linked to a particular format of ID3 tags? Does it depend on Music running in a Mac OS environment (Catalina 10.15.7)?

    Apple cannot read any tags, from any wave files. Use AIFF instead.
